Output 8b84f9e29240826d13a2b1805d7ba4a37e57a296af0532abf240c26d0e1d6bc8:0

value
849241241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beb30f4d47fbf809394f1157654c0c3dd300f8 OP_EQUAL
address
3FtX7JoMRXHqREuQ6mCKr84HDqKBBxR2MA
transaction
8b84f9e29240826d13a2b1805d7ba4a37e57a296af0532abf240c26d0e1d6bc8
spent
true